Job overview

The Night Auditor is responsible for the preparation and disposition of all night audit checklist work and reports. The primary responsibility of a Night Auditor is to deliver and exceed guest expectations, execute brand service standards, resolve guest challenges and ensure accuracy in our nightly posting and reporting.

Your day-to-day
  • Check all hotel guests in and out in a confident, professional and personalized manner.
  • Welcome and register hotel guests, explain the accommodations and establish the credit or method of payment.
  • Demonstrate a thorough knowledge of hotel information, including but not limited to room categories, room rates, packages, promotions, amenities, the local area and other general product knowledge, and answer guest inquiries.
  • Maintain regular attendance in compliance with LodgeWorks’ standards as required by scheduling, which varies according to hotel needs.
  • Take hotel reservations accurately and efficiently.
  • Ensure that immediate response is given to every guest comment and concern to ensure that it is resolved in a timely, friendly and efficient manner.
  • Maintain accuracy with all accounting, cash handling and billing procedures.
  • Be familiar with and follow tax-exempt policies and procedures.
  • Ensure that all calls are answered in a courteous, professional and efficient manner.
  • Use hotel communication tools to log and notify fellow associates and supervisors of pertinent information.
  • Provide accounting support to the hotel by ensuring that all revenues are posted to the correct department, balance the guest ledger on a daily basis and complete all necessary reports.
  • Submit appropriate reports to corporate in a timely manner.
  • Assist in any other task or duties as requested by management.
